Residential Proxies: What They Are

Residential proxies route requests through IP addresses assigned by internet service providers to real households, so traffic looks like an ordinary home connection.

Strengths

  • High trust on strict sites
  • Broad geo coverage
  • Good for account-sensitive tasks

Limitations

  • Higher cost per GB
  • Variable speed
  • Bandwidth-metered billing is common

Best for: Strict targets, geo-specific research, and workflows where trust matters more than raw speed. Pricing model: Usually billed by bandwidth (per GB). Detection profile: Low block risk on most consumer-facing sites when paced correctly.

Survey and Geo Testing: Workflow and Fit

Validate that surveys, forms, and geo-targeted experiences display correctly to different regional audiences.

Recommended proxy types: Residential, Mobile, Rotating Residential, ISP. Low, with distinct sessions per region and audience.

  1. Define target regions and audiences
  2. Access surveys through geo-matched proxies
  3. Verify targeting and display logic
  4. Test quota and eligibility rules
  5. Capture regional variations
  6. Report display and routing issues

Risks to manage

  • Duplicate or fraudulent responses
  • Geo mismatches skewing targeting
  • Detection of automated access
  • Panel quality controls blocking sessions

Metrics to track

  • Geo accuracy
  • Session success rate
  • Targeting correctness
  • Coverage across regions

Common Mistakes

  • Reusing one IP across many accounts and linking them.
  • Failing to log tests, so results cannot be reproduced.
  • Rotating too aggressively during login or checkout sessions.
  • Assuming the cheapest plan is automatically the best value.
  • Not budgeting for retries and replacement IPs.
